What this page covers

This guide explains how NZD casino banking works at online casinos, what to check before you deposit, and how to avoid the common mistakes that cause withdrawal delays or bonus disputes.

Quick checklist for NZ players

  • Choose a licensed casino with clear ownership and published terms
  • Confirm the payment method is available for both deposits and withdrawals (where possible)
  • Read bonus rules before opting in, especially game contribution and max cash-out limits
  • Complete identity checks early to avoid payout delays
  • Set limits and treat gambling as entertainment, not income

Deposits, withdrawals, and fees

Payment processing depends on both the casino and your provider. Deposits are often instant, while withdrawals may take longer due to internal reviews. Check limits and fees before you deposit.

A smart approach is a small test deposit, confirming the preferred withdrawal method in the cashier, and completing verification early.

Is NZD casino banking legal for New Zealand players?

NZ players can access offshore online casinos that accept New Zealand customers. Choose reputable, licensed operators and read terms carefully.

Are winnings taxed in New Zealand?

Recreational gambling winnings are generally not taxed in New Zealand, but personal circumstances can vary.
